Papaya and Lychee Information

Color of a fruit helps in determining its nutrient content and hence, its nutritional value. Therefore, color can considered as an important factor of Papaya and Lychee Information. Papaya is found in shades of orange and yellow and Lychee is found in shades of bright red and pink red. Get Papaya vs Lychee characteristics comparison of the basis of properties like their taste, texture, color, size, seasonal availability and much more! Papaya belongs to Melon, Tree Fruit category whereas Lychee belongs to Tree Fruit, Tropical category. Papaya originated in Mexico and Central America while Lychee originated in China, Indonesia, Philippines and Vietnam.

Papaya and Lychee Varieties

Papaya and Lychee varieties form an important part of Papaya vs Lychee characteristics. Due to advancements and development in the field of horticulture science, it is possible to get many varieties of Papaya and Lychee. The varieties of Papaya are Coorg Honey Dew, Pusa Dwarf, Pusa Giant, Pusa Majesty, Pusa Delicious, Pusa Dwarf, Solo, Ranchi, Taiwan-785 and Taiwan-786 whereas the varieties of Lychee are Emperor fruit, Mauritiu, Sweet Heart, Brewster, Haak Yip and Bengal. The shape of Papaya and Lychee is Oval and Oval respecitely. Talking about the taste, Papaya is luscious and sweet in taste and Lychee is crunchy, juicy and sweet.
